About Company:

Vitafoam Nigeria Plc is one of the most recognized manufacturing brands in Nigeria and West Africa, primarily known for its sleep solutions and polyurethane products.

Qualifications and Skills:

Professional Profile

  • Education: Bachelor’s Degree (B.Sc.) or HND in Mechanical Engineering or a related discipline.

  • Experience: 3 – 5 years of hands-on mechanical maintenance experience (FMCG or Chemical Processing preferred).

  • Technical Power: Proficiency in reading technical blueprints and schematics; familiarity with CAD (AutoCAD/SolidWorks).

  • Software IQ: Familiarity with modern Maintenance Management Systems.

  • Soft Skills: Strong analytical problem-solving skills and a proactive attitude toward workplace safety.
